Abstract: | Eunjung Lim, lecturer at Johns Hopkins University, explains that “The appearance of President Park, democratically elected head of American ally South Korea, watching an extravagant Chinese military parade that gave the image of targeting the US was perplexing and even frustrating to many Americans.” |
